which of the following describes a reason historians might want to use a primary source to study an event
baherus [9]
A primary source comes from someone who lived during the time of the event or they were at the event. The reason why historians want primary source is because it is more likely to be factual and will give the best information. For example, at the signing of the declaration of independence several of the men who signed it wrote diaries . That would be considered a primary source, because those men were there and saw it as well as documented the event.
